Summary

This episode features ecommerce veteran Steve Simonson, who built and sold iFloor.com, sharing his extensive experience. He emphasizes the critical importance of implementing systems and processes early in a business's lifecycle to facilitate scale and efficiency, particularly in the challenging zero to $1 million revenue stage. The discussion provides valuable perspectives on growth phases and the strategic documentation of procedures to retain knowledge.

Frequently asked about this episode

What does this episode say about founder & leadership?
Implement systems and processes from the earliest stages (zero to $1 million revenue) to ensure faster, more efficient growth and prevent chaos.
What does this episode say about supply chain & operations?
Prioritize documenting recurring tasks and pain points into systems, starting with simple flowcharts or written procedures before investing in complex tech solutions.
What does this episode say about brand & content?
Understand that growth phases differ: zero to $1M is chaotic, $1M-$10M is about systematizing, and $10M-$50M is about scaling. Recognize where your business is and adapt your strategy.
What does this episode say about founder & leadership?
Document company knowledge (SOPs) to ease hiring, promotion, and prevent loss of institutional wisdom when team members leave.
What does this episode say about founder & leadership?
Don't get bogged down by finding the 'perfect' system; use readily available, low-barrier tools like Google Drive or Evernote, or even pen and paper, to start documenting immediately.
